Nal Sarovar Bird Sanctuary, consisting primarily of a 120.82-sqkm lake and ambient marshes. It is situated about 64 km to the west of Ahmedabad in the Gujarat state . Mainly inhabited bymigratory birds in the winter and spring season, it is the largest wetland bird sanctuary in Gujarat, and one of the largest in India. It was declared a bird sanctuary in April 1969 Nalsarovar was declared as a Ramsar site on 24 September 2012.
